Japji Pauri 21 also known as Tirath Tap 

Complete Mantra: 
tirath tap da-i-aa dat daan. 
jay ko paavai til kaa maan. 
suni-aa mani-aa man keetaa bhaa-o. 
antargat tirath mal naa-o. 
sabh gun tayray mai naahee ko-ay. 
vin gun keetay bhagat na ho-ay. 
su-asat aath banee barmaa-o. 
sat suhaan sadaa man chaa-o. 
kavan so vaylaa vakhat kavan kavan thit kavan vaar. 
kavan se rutee maahu kavan jit ho-aa aakaar. 
vayl na paa-ee-aa pandtee je hovai laykh puraan. 
vakhat na paa-i-o kaadee-aa je likhan laykh kuraan. 
thit vaar naa jogee jaanai rut maahu naa ko-ee. 
jaa kartaa sirthee ka-o saajay aapay jaanai so-ee. 
kiv kar aakhaa kiv saalaahee ki-o varnee kiv jaanaa. 
naanak aakhan sabh ko aakhai ik doo ik si-aanaa. 
vadaa saahib vadee naa-ee keetaa jaa kaa hovai. 
naanak jay ko aapou jaanai agai ga-i-aa na sohai. ||21|| 

More Information: 
Pilgrimages, ritual discipline, compassion and charity on their own 
these, by themselves, bring only tiny amount of honor. 
Listening and believing with love and humility in your mind, 
cleanse yourself by repeating the Name at the sacred shrine deep within. 
All virtues are Yours, Beloved, I have none at all. 
Without virtue, there is no devotional worship. 
I bow to the Beloved One, to the Divine Word, to Brahma the Creator. 
The Creator is Beautiful, True and Eternally Joyful. 
What was that time, and what was that moment? What was that day, and what was that date? 
What was that season, and what was that month, when the Universe was created? 
The Sages, the religious scholars, cannot find that time, even if it is written in the scriptures. 
That time is not known to the Qazis, who study the Koran. 
The day and the date are not known to the Yogīs, nor is the month or the season. 
The Creator who created this creation – only that Creator knows. 
How can we speak of the Divine? How can we praise the One? How can we describe the Beloved? How can we know the One? 
O Nanak, everyone speaks of the Divine, each one wiser than the rest. 
Great is the Master, Great the Name. Whatever happens is according to divine will. 
O Nanak, one who claims to know everything shall not be decorated in the world hereafter. ||21||
